Evodiamine inhibits RANKL‐induced osteoclastogenesis and prevents ovariectomy‐induced bone loss in mice
Postmenopausal osteoporosis (PMO) is a progressive bone disease characterized by the over‐production and activation of osteoclasts in elderly women. In our study, we investigated the anti‐osteoclastogenic effect of evodiamine (EVO) in vivo and in vitro, as well as the underlying mechanism. By using...
